- The distance between Blue River, Bc, Canada and Johnstown, Pa, Usa is approximately 3,318 km or 2,062 mi.
- To reach Blue River, Bc in this distance one would set out from Johnstown, Pa bearing 307°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Blue River, Bc bearing 277.1° or W .
- Blue River, Bc has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Johnstown, Pa has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Blue River, Bc is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Johnstown, Pa is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.5 °C (11.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.6 °C (1.1°F) more in Blue River, Bc.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 253 mm (10 in) less which is equivalent to 253 l/m² (6.21 US gal/ft²) or 2,530,000 l/ha (270,474 US gal/ac) less. About 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.8° lower in Blue River, Bc than in Johnstown, Pa.
